The Bonnyvale Environmental Education Center (BEEC) is a member-based, nonprofit organization, founded in 1991 to develop a more ecologically informed and involved citizenry through education and action.
BEEC offers a wide variety of environmental
programs to adults and children of all ages, including:

  • School-based natural science programs.
  • Youth nature camps.
  • Citizen-based reptile and amphibian conservation.
  • “Big Night” Salamander Crossing Brigades Project.
  • Natural history programs.
  • Biodiversity education and protection initiatives.
  • Presentations on issues of regional concern.
  • Interpretive hiking trails.
